/*-----------------------------
	GLOBAL CONTENT
-----------------------------*/

body {background-color: #ffffff;text-decoration: none;color: #000000;font-family: Arial, sans-serif;font-size: 0.9em;line-height: 150%; font-weight: lighter; margin: 0px; overflow:none; overflow-x:hidden;}

h1{text-decoration: none;font-family: Arial, sans-serif; font-size: 3em; line-height: 50%; font-weight: lighter;}
h2{text-decoration: none;font-family: Arial, sans-serif; font-size: 1.8em; line-height: 0%; font-weight: lighter;}
h3{text-decoration: none;font-family: Arial, sans-serif; font-size: 1.2em; line-height: 50%; font-weight: lighter;}
h4{text-decoration: none;font-family: Arial, sans-serif; font-size: 0.9em; line-height: 0%; font-weight: bold;}

.text{text-decoration: none;font-family: Arial, sans-serif;font-size:0.9em;font-weight:normal;color: #656464;}
p {line-height:140%;}
li {margin-left:20px;line-height:125%;}


a.footer:link {text-decoration: none;color: #656464; font-size:0.9em;}
a.footer:visited {text-decoration: none;color: #656464; font-size:0.9em;}
a.footer:active {text-decoration: none;color: #656464; font-size:0.9em;}
a.footer:hover {text-decoration: none;color: #c1c1c1; font-size:0.9em;}


/* ######### ALL WRAPPERS ######### */

#globalheader_wrapper {background-color:#28915a; color:white;position: absolute;top: 0px;left: 0px;width: 100%;height: 25px;margin-left: auto;margin-right: auto;}
#globalheader {position:relative;top: 2px;left:0px;width: 670px;text-align: right;margin-left: auto;margin-right: auto;font-size: 0.9em;}

#header_wrapper {position: absolute;top: 20px;left: 20px;vertical-align:top;width: 100%;height: 70px;margin-left: auto;margin-right: auto;}
#header {position: relative;top: 0px;left:0px;width: 700px;height: 70px;text-align: left;margin-left: auto;margin-right: auto;}

#footer_wrapper {position: relative;top: 810px;left: 0px;vertical-align:top;width: 100%;height: auto;margin-left: auto;margin-right: auto;}
#footer {position: relative;top: 0px;left:0px;width: 700px;height: 160px;text-align: center;margin-left: auto;margin-right: auto;font-size:0.9em; color:grey;}

#content_wrapper {position: absolute;top: 80px;left: 0px;vertical-align:top;width: 100%;height: 700px;margin-left: auto;margin-right: auto;}
#content_case {background-image: url('../images/appform.png');background-repeat: no-repeat; position: relative;top: 0px;left:0px;width: 700px;height:699px;margin-left: auto;margin-right: auto;}
#content_top {color:white;position: relative;top: 35px;left:30px;width: 670px;height: 40px;text-align: left;margin-left: auto;margin-right: auto;}
#content_form {
    position: relative;
    top: 80px;
    height: 400px;
    text-align: left;
    margin-left: 60px;
    margin-right: 30px;
    width:auto;
}
		

input, select {
	color: #283732;
	background-color: white;
	border: 1px solid #788c82;
}

tr.formfield {
    vertical-align: top;
    text-align: left;
    color: #283732;
    background-color: transparent;
    /* font-size: 12px; */
    font-size: 0.9em;
    text-decoration: none;
}
td.fieldname {
    text-align: left;
    padding: 5px;
}
td.fieldvalue {
    text-align: left;
    padding: 1px;
}
span.error {
    color: red;
}
h1.enquiry {
/*     font-family: Verdana, Arial, Helvetica, sans-serif; */
    font-family: Century Gothic, Tahoma, Arial, sans-serif;
    text-align: left;
    font-size: 1.2em;
    font-weight: bold;
    width: 100%;
    color: #000000;
    border-bottom: 1px solid #9f5236;
    margin-top: 10px;
    margin-left: 10px;
}
p.instructions {
    text-align: center;
    font-size: 0.9em;
}
.error{
    color:red;
    font-size:0.7em;
}
p.instructions_l {
    text-align: left;
    font-size: 0.9em;
}
div.instructions {
    background-color: #EEEEEE;
    border: 1px solid #888888;
    padding: 5px;
    margin: 5px;
    width: 550px;
    z-index:22;
}
td.sectionheading {
    padding-left: 5px;
    padding-top: 3px;
    padding-bottom: 5px;
    font-weight: bold;
    font-size: 1.1em;
}
.charity {
    vertical-align: top;
    text-align: left;
    color: #030303;
    font-size:0.7em;
}
.charityad{
    position:absolute;
    z-index:345;
    display:'';
    visibility:visible;
}
.charityad_h{
    display:none;
    visibility:hidden;
}
.charitylink{
    cursor:pointer;
}
.charitylink_template{
    width:205px;
    cursor:pointer;
    position:relative;
    top:0px;
    right:0px;
    border:0px solid red;
    float:right;
    z-index:345;
}
.charityad_template{
   cursor:pointer;
    position:relative;
    top:0px;
    right:0px;
    border:0px solid red;
    z-index:345;
    visibility:visible;
}

/*-----------------------------
	FOOTER
-----------------------------*/

a.seo_footer:link {text-decoration: none;color: #283732;font-size: 8pt;}
a.seo_footer:visited {text-decoration: none;color: #788c82;font-size: 8pt;}
a.seo_footer:active {text-decoration: none;color: #283732;font-size: 8pt;}
a.seo_footer:hover {text-decoration: none;color: #283732;font-size: 8pt;}




